What is Kefir? - MSNThere are two types of kefir: milk-based and water-based. Milk kefir is creamy, while water kefir is lighter and dairy-free, sometimes flavored with fruit or herbs like kombucha.
Kefir is a type of fermented milk that may help manage blood sugar, lower cholesterol, and boost digestive health, among other benefits. However, more evidence is needed to back some of these claims.

Kefir Fermentation. Kefir is a type of fermented milk, usually cow's milk. It has an acidic, almost citric, sour taste. Kefir contains kefir grains, live bacteria, and yeast.
